Shanghai's commitment to sustainability is evident in its comprehensive green urban planning initiatives. The city has implemented strict zoning regulations to balance development with ecological preservation, creating a network of urban green spaces that include parks, wetlands, and rooftop gardens. The recently completed Shanghai Yangtze River Estuary National Nature Reserve Urban Ecological Corridor exemplifies this approach, connecting fragmented habitats and providing residents with accessible natural spaces while serving as a buffer against flooding and improving air quality.

The city's transportation sector has seen a significant shift towards low-carbon alternatives. Shanghai's extensive public transportation system, already one of the most efficient in the world, continues to expand with the addition of new metro lines and bus rapid transit routes. The city has also embraced electric vehicles (EVs), with over 500,000 EVs on its roads and a rapidly growing network of charging stations. The Shanghai International Automobile City, a hub for automotive innovation, is leading the charge in EV research and production, attracting global manufacturers and startups alike.

Renewable energy adoption is another cornerstone of Shanghai's green strategy. While the city's geographical constraints limit large-scale solar and wind projects within its boundaries, Shanghai has invested heavily in offshore wind farms in the East China Sea. The Shanghai Electric Wind Power Base, one of the largest offshore wind projects in Asia, began operations in 2022 and now supplies clean electricity to hundreds of thousands of households. Additionally, the city has implemented building-integrated photovoltaics (BIPV) in new constructions, turning skyscrapers into vertical power plants.

Shanghai's approach to waste management sets new standards for urban sustainability. The city has achieved an impressive waste sorting rate of over 95%, thanks to a combination of strict regulations, public education campaigns, and technological innovations. Advanced waste-to-energy plants convert non-recyclable waste into electricity while minimizing environmental impact. The Laogang Renewable Resource Recycling Center, one of the largest of its kind in the world, processes over 7 million tons of waste annually, generating enough electricity to power 100,000 homes.

The city's water management systems demonstrate Shanghai's holistic approach to environmental protection. The Suzhou Creek Revitalization Project has transformed a once heavily polluted waterway into a vibrant urban artery, with improved water quality, restored riverbanks, and new public spaces. Meanwhile, the Yangtze River Delta Ecological Green Belt initiative aims to crteeaa contiguous ecological corridor that will protect biodiversity while providing recreational opportunities for residents.

Shanghai's smart city initiatives are leveraging cutting-edge technology to enhance sustainability. The city's 5G network, one of the most extensive in the world, supports a wide range of applications from intelligent traffic management to precision agriculture in suburban areas. Big data analytics help optimize energy consumption across the city's buildings, while AI-powered systems monitor air quality and predict pollution patterns to enable proactive interventions.

The financial sector plays a crucial role in Shanghai's green transformation. The Shanghai Environment and Energy Exchange, established in 2021, has become a hub for carbon trading and green finance innovation. The exchange has launched several pioneering products, including carbon neutrality bonds and environmental benefit rights trading, attracting both domestic and international investors. This financial infrastructure supports the city's goal of achieving carbon peaking before 2030 and carbon neutrality by 2060.

Shanghai's commitment to sustainability extends beyond its borders through international cooperation. The city hosts the annual China International Import Expo (CIIE), which includes a dedicated green technology exhibition area showcasing the latest innovations in sustainable development. Shanghai also participates actively in global climate initiatives, sharing its experiences and learning from other leading cities through platforms like C40 Cities Climate Leadership Group.

Despite these impressive achievements, Shanghai faces significant challenges in its quest for sustainability. The city's population continues to grow, putting pressure on resources and infrastructure. Balancing economic development with environmental protection remains an ongoing challenge, particularly in industrial zones undergoing transformation. Climate change impacts, including rising sea levels and extreme weather events, require continuous adaptation measures.

Looking ahead, Shanghai's sustainability roadmap includes several ambitious projects. The Yangshan Special Comprehensive Bonded Zone is being developed as a hub for green trade and circular economy innovation. The Shanghai Hydrogen Energy Innovation Center aims to position the city as a leader in hydrogen fuel cell technology. Meanwhile, the ongoing digital transformation of urban services promises to make resource management even more efficient through real-time monitoring and predictive analytics.
